Understanding the Mack LR Electric
The Mack LR Electric is a heavy-duty, all-electric refuse truck designed for urban waste collection. It combines Mack’s durability with zero-emission technology, making it ideal for cities aiming to reduce their carbon footprint.
Pre-Trip Checklist
- Inspect battery charge levels and ensure sufficient range for your route.
- Check tire pressure and condition for safety and efficiency.
- Verify fluid levels, including windshield washer fluid and brake fluid.
- Test all lights and signals to ensure visibility.
- Ensure that the charging equipment is operational and available.
Charging Tips
Proper charging is vital for maintaining optimal vehicle performance. Use the recommended charger and follow the manufacturer’s guidelines for charging times. Consider scheduling charges during off-peak hours to save costs and reduce grid load.
Driving the Mack LR Electric
Driving an electric refuse truck differs from traditional diesel models. Accelerate smoothly to conserve battery life, and utilize regenerative braking to recharge the battery during stops. Monitor your range regularly to avoid unexpected power loss.
Safety and Maintenance
Safety is paramount when operating electric vehicles. Wear appropriate PPE, and be aware of high-voltage components. Regular maintenance includes checking battery health, updating software, and inspecting electrical connections to ensure longevity and safety.
